In the morning, head to the iconic Gateway of India and enjoy the magnificent view of the Arabian Sea. Take a ferry ride to Elephanta Caves and explore the ancient rock-cut temples. In the afternoon, treat yourself to a delicious seafood lunch at one of the local restaurants near the Gateway. As the evening sets in, explore Colaba Causeway for shopping and indulge in street food delights like Vada Pav and Pani Puri. Estimated cost: $30-40 per person. Estimated time spent: Full day.
Embark on a cultural journey by visiting key heritage sites in Mumbai. Start your morning with a visit to the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Vastu Sangrahalaya (formerly Prince of Wales Museum) and explore its magnificent collections. For lunch, savor local delicacies at Britannia & Co. Restaurant, known for its Parsi cuisine. In the afternoon, dive into the history of Bollywood at Film City and take a studio tour. Enjoy the evening at Marine Drive, a picturesque promenade along the Arabian Sea, and witness a mesmerizing sunset. Indulge in street food or opt for a meal at one of the seaside restaurants. Estimated cost: $25-35 per person. Estimated time spent: Full day.
Discover the modern side of Mumbai today. Start your morning with a visit to Bandra-Worli Sea Link, an architectural marvel connecting the suburbs to the city. Head to Bandra, known as the "Queen of Suburbs," and explore its vibrant streets. Enjoy a leisurely lunch at one of the trendy cafes in Bandra. In the afternoon, visit the Nehru Science Centre for a fun and interactive experience. Experience the nightlife at Juhu Beach, lined with restaurants and pubs, where you can enjoy dinner and possibly catch a live performance. Estimated cost: $20-30 per person. Estimated time spent: Full day.
Experience the vibrant local markets and flavors of Mumbai. Begin your day by visiting Crawford Market, a bustling market known for its variety of goods. Sample street food delights like Bhel Puri and Pav Bhaji for a quick lunch. In the afternoon, explore the Dharavi Slum and gain insights into the resilient spirit of its residents. Later, indulge in retail therapy at Fashion Street, a popular shopping destination for budget shoppers. End your evening with a flavorful dinner at Mohammed Ali Road, famous for its mouth-watering street food during the festive season. Estimated cost: $15-25 per person. Estimated time spent: Full day.
As a city experience enthusiast, you should not miss exploring Kala Ghoda, a vibrant neighborhood filled with art galleries, museums, and cafes. Stroll through the streets of Colaba and explore its charming art deco architecture. For a serene escape, visit Sanjay Gandhi National Park, where you can hike through nature trails and spot wildlife. To experience Mumbai's local train culture, take a ride on the Western Line during non-peak hours. Don't forget to explore the food stalls at Chowpatty Beach, especially during the annual Ganesh Chaturthi festival. These hidden gems and local favorites will give you a deeper understanding of Mumbai's culture and charm.
